Remotely upgrading/updating Adobe Creative Suite 2

We have around 30 Mac clients running on our network and I need to upgrade several of them to the latest CS2 versions. They all already have CS2 install, so are just normal Adobe updates, but I'd like to push them out with ARD if possible. Has anyone done this successfully? If so, any info you can provide would be much appreciated. Thanks in advance.

I'm in the same boat on this one. We also have about 30 Macs running on our network, and I've been trying to figure this one out for quite sometime. I've been going at it from the angle of looking for a unix command to run adobe updater, similar to that for installing apple updates through ARD. I've had no success in locating this information, as of yet. I also tried to create a package of the updates at one point, but that didn't work out so well, due to it needing admin rights to install still, which puts me back to still having to connect to each individual machine, plus if I remember correctly there were permission issues as a result; it's been a while since I tried that out, so can't recall all the details, but it didn't work out for me.   • Looking to upgrade from Adobe Creative Suite 3 Production Premium to the latest.

    I am looking to upgrade from Adobe Creative Suite 3 Production Premium to the latest. We are running on an isolated network without access to the Internet. Looking for advise on how best to proceed.

    As far as upgrading goes, you will not have that option for CS3 as it is not in the upgrade path for CS6.  You will have to purchase the full version of CS6.  I don't know if buying the disk is still an option, but if you have to you can download the installation file(s) and copy to a removeable media and install using that.  In order to activate it you will have to perform an offline activation.

  • I have Adobe Creative Suite 5 Design Premium (Teacher and Student Edition.  I've purchased the upgrade to Adobe Photoshop CS6 - Trying to install, but it says my serial number is invalid?

    I have Adobe Creative Suite 5 Design Premium (Teacher and Student Edition).  I've purchased the upgrade to Adobe Photoshop CS6 - Trying to install, and it says the Adobe CS6 is valid - but only provides 'photoshop' options for entering my old serial number, rather than the adobe creative suite. How do I move past this so I can download it on my computer.  I don't want to upgrade to Adobe Creative Suite 6 - as I do not need all the programs, just photoshop.  From looking online, I read forums that said this was possible.  Please advise

    I don't want to upgrade to Adobe Creative Suite 6 - as I do not need all the programs, just photoshop.
    Unfortunately that option is not possible.
    You cannot upgrade a Creative Suite to a standalone product.
    Creative Suites can only be upgrades to other Creative Suites.
    You'll need to return Photoshop CS6 upgrade since you cannot use it.
    Return, cancel, or exchange an Adobe order
    Some options:
    Buy a Creative Suite upgrade, or
    Buy a full new copy of Photoshop CS6, or
    Join the Cloud
